CHOCOLATE ICE CREAM CONE WITH BROWNIE CHUNKS & FUDGE DRIZZLE

A rich chocolate ice cream loaded with fudgy brownie chunks and topped with warm chocolate ganache.



INGREDIENTS

For the Chocolate Ice Cream:

2 cups (480ml) heavy cream

1 cup (240ml) whole milk

¾ cup (150g) granulated sugar

½ cup (45g) unsweetened cocoa powder

100g (3.5 oz) dark chocolate, chopped

1 tsp vanilla extract

Pinch of salt

For the Brownie Chunks:

1 cup prepared brownies, cut into small cubes (use your favorite homemade or store-bought brownies)

For the Fudge Drizzle:

½ cup (120ml) heavy cream

½ cup (90g) semisweet chocolate chips

1 tbsp butter

¼ tsp vanilla extract

Optional:

Ice cream cones or waffle bowls



INSTRUCTIONS

1. Make the Chocolate Ice Cream:

In a saucepan, whisk together milk, sugar, salt, and cocoa powder.

Heat until warm, then add chopped dark chocolate and whisk until smooth.

Remove from heat, stir in heavy cream and vanilla.

Chill the mixture in the fridge for at least 4 hours or overnight.

2. Churn:

Pour the chilled mixture into an ice cream maker and churn according to manufacturer’s instructions.

In the last 2–3 minutes, fold in the brownie chunks.

Transfer to a freezer container and freeze for at least 4 hours until firm.

3. Prepare the Fudge Drizzle:

Heat cream in a saucepan until simmering, remove from heat.

Add chocolate chips and butter, let sit for 1 minute.

Stir until smooth, then mix in vanilla extract. Let cool slightly.

4. Assemble:

Scoop chocolate ice cream into a cone.

Add extra brownie chunks on top.

Drizzle with warm fudge sauce.
